Bayside Presbyterian Preschool And Kindergarden

1400 Ewell Rd
Virginia Beach, VA 23455
Bayside Presbyterian Preschool And Kindergarden serves 155 students in grades Prekindergarten-Kindergarten.
The student:teacher of Bayside Presbyterian Preschool And Kindergarden is 17: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Presbyterian.
